首页 > php学习 > php如何汉字转拼音?一个函数搞定

php如何汉字转拼音?一个函数搞定

2015年10月10日 发表评论 阅读评论

function getEnFirst($cn){
$ch=curl_init();
$url=’http://apis.baidu.com/xiaogg/changetopinyin/topinyin?str=’.$cn.’&type=json&traditional=0&accent=0&letter=0&only_chinese=0′;
$header=array(‘apikey:4d7329d7fa6b6e4fee78d904076350ca’);
curl_setopt($ch,CURLOPT_HTTPHEADER,$header);
curl_setopt($ch,CURLOPT_RETURNTRANSFER,1);
curl_setopt($ch,CURLOPT_URL,$url);
$en=json_decode(curl_exec($ch),true);
curl_close($ch);
return $en[‘pinyin’];
}

php如何将指定的汉字转换为拼音?利用百度提供的api接口,自己写了个函数,搞定。

 

或者直接用file_get_contents,curl获取以下内容:

http://2.ibtf.sinaapp.com/pinyin/?str=汉字&apiserviceid=1124

分类: php学习 标签: , ,
  1. 本文目前尚无任何评论.
您必须在 登录 后才能发布评论.
css.php